Ngokwethiyori, amandla ombaneizibane zesitalato zelangaiyafana neyezibane zesitalato ze-LED. Nangona kunjalo, izibane zesitalato zelanga azisetyenziswa ngumbane, ngoko ke zithintelwa zizinto ezifana netekhnoloji yephaneli kunye nebhetri. Ke ngoko, izibane zesitalato zelanga ngokubanzi azinawo amandla aphezulu kakhulu. Ngokubanzi, i-120W yeyona iphezulu. Naluphi na amandla aphezulu angabeka emngciphekweni ukhuseleko, ngoko ke ukuyigcina ngaphakathi kwe-100W yeyona ndlela ikhuselekileyo.

Enyanisweni, ukhetho lwamandla ombane lusekelwe kwisizathu esithile. Xa ucwangcisa izibane zesitalato zelanga, kufuneka uqale umisele amandla ombane esibane. Ngokubanzi, iindlela zasemaphandleni zifuna ii-watts ezingama-30-60, ngelixa iindlela zasezidolophini zifuna ii-watts ezingama-60 nangaphezulu.
Amandla ombane esibaneni sendlela selanga adla ngokukhethwa ngokusekelwe kububanzi bendlela kunye nokuphakama kweepali, okanye ngokulingana nemigangatho yokukhanyisa indlela:
1. Umgama wokufakelwa kwezibane zesitalato zelanga (icala elinye): 10W, ifanelekile ukuphakama kweepali ze-2m-3m;
2. Umgama wokufakelwa kwezibane zesitalato zelanga (icala elinye): 15W, ifanelekile ukuphakama kweepali ze-3m-4m;
3. Umgama wokufakelwa kwezibane zesitalato zelanga (icala elinye): 20W, ifanelekile ukuphakama kweepali eziyi-5m-6m (kwiindlela eziyi-6-8m ububanzi, 5m ububanzi; kwiindlela eziyi-8-10m ububanzi, 6m ububanzi, kunye neendlela ezimbini);
4. Umgama wokufakelwa kwezibane zesitalato zelanga (icala elinye): 30W, ifanelekile ukuphakama kweepali eziyi-6m-7m (kwiindlela ezibubanzi obuyi-8-10m, iindlela ezimbini);
5. Umgama wokufakelwa kwezibane zesitalato zelanga (icala elinye): 40W, ifanelekile ukuphakama kweepali eziyi-6m-7m (kwiindlela ezibubanzi obuyi-8-10m, iindlela ezimbini);
6. Umgama wokufakelwa kwezibane zesitalato zelanga (icala elinye): 50W, ifanelekile ukuphakama kweepali eziyi-6m-7m (ifanelekile kwiindlela ezibubanzi obuyi-8-10m, iindlela ezi-2);
7. Umgama wokufakelwa kwezibane zesitalato zelanga (icala elinye): 60W, ifanelekile ukuphakama kweepali eziyi-7m-8m (ifanelekile kwiindlela ezibubanzi obuyi-10-15m, iindlela ezi-3);
8. Umgama wokufakelwa kwezibane zesitalato zelanga (icala elinye): 80W, ifanelekile ukuphakama kweepali eziyi-8m (ifanelekile kwiindlela ezibubanzi obuyi-10-15m, iindlela ezi-3);
9. Umgama wokufakelwa kwezibane zesitalato zelanga (icala elinye): 100W kunye ne-120W, zilungele ukuphakama kweepali ze-10-12m nangaphezulu.
Amava angentla asekelwe kumandla apheleleyo, nto leyo eyahlukileyo kumanqanaba amandla anyusiweyo afumaneka kwimarike. Kwimarike, amazinga eeparameter zezibane zelanga ezinyusiweyo aqhelekile. Ukungabikho kwemigangatho efanayo yesizwe okanye yeshishini yezibane zelanga kukhokelele ekudidekeni kwemarike. Abathengi badla ngokugxila kuphela kumanqanaba amandla, okwenza kube nzima ukuba iimveliso ezinemilinganiselo echanekileyo enyusiweyo zibonakale.
